Chapter 53: SSL E Channel Strip

Dynamics

Separate “soft-knee” compressor/limiter and expansion/gate modules are
available in the dynamics section. Each module has their own set of controls.

Compressor/Limiter

Link

When UAD SSL E Channel Strip is used in a stereo-in/stereo-out
configuration, two separate dynamics processors are active (one
for each stereo channel). When Link is engaged, the two compres-
sors are constrained so that they both compress by the same
amount at any instant.

This prevents transients which appear only on one channel from shifting the
stereo image of the output. Any big transient on either channel will cause both
channels to compress.

Link is active when its amber LED is illuminated. When the plug-in is used in
a mono-input configuration, Link has no affect.

Compress Ratio

Ratio defines the amount of gain reduction to be processed
by the compressor. For example, a value of 2 (expressed as
a 2:1 ratio) reduces the signal above the threshold by half,
with an input signal of 20 dB being attenuated to 10 dB.

The UAD SSL E Channel Strip compressor offers a continu-
ously variable ratio between 1:1 (no compression) and infin-
ity:1 (limiting).

Note:

Signals must exceed the Threshold value before they are attenuated by

the Ratio amount.

Compress

Threshold

Threshold defines the signal level at which the onset of com-
pression occurs. Incoming signals that exceed this level are
compressed. Signals below the level are unaffected.

The available range is +10 dB to –20 dB. Rotate the control
clockwise for more compression.
